The Repository main menu item has the options 'Commit All' and 'Commit Staged Changes'.

What is the difference between those options ?

(to me they seem to be identical)

Commit all will take all your changes and add them to the commit, equivalent to git commit --all. Commit staged changes will only commit changed files that you have already added to the staging area.
